664.64.16 Arctostaphylos viscidaManzanita.
Source: North American.
MindSplit between the mind and the body.
Estranged from the earthly world.
Aversion to the physical world and physical body, from religious, philosophical or spiritual ideas.
Feeling that the body is ugly and corrupted, or that it has little intrinsic worth compared to the spirit.
Body is often highly objectified, exploited, deprived, < spiritual, ascetic regimens.
Bulimia or anorexia.
BodyGeneral: diabetes.
Rectum: diarrhoea.
Urinary: bladder catarrh.
Male: gonorrhoea.
Female: leucorrhoea, menorrhagia; inflammation glandula bulbourethralis, cowperitis.
